CXF webService
光晓军
这个作者很懒,什么都没留下…
展开
-
CXF入门
又一HelloWorld示例,老套的HelloWorld是入门经典。也是基础和必须掌握的,下面看看HelloWorldWebService,很简单。 需要的jar包如下: 1、 HelloWorldService服务器端代码 package com.hoo.service; import javax.jws.WebParam;import javax.jws转载 2015-09-08 15:48:28 · 440 阅读 · 0 评论 -
二、CXF与springMVC整合的webService客户端调用
1、在另外一个项目中,调用已经发布好的webService时,首先在客户端项目中创建一个接口如下:package com.gstd.c;import javax.jws.WebParam;import javax.jws.WebService;import javax.jws.soap.SOAPBinding;import javax.jws.soap.SOAPBinding.原创 2015-09-09 17:26:04 · 4264 阅读 · 0 评论 -
CXF对Interceptor拦截器的支持
前面在Axis中介绍过Axis的Handler,这里CXF的Interceptor就和Handler的功能类似。在每个请求响应之前或响应之后,做一些事情。这里的Interceptor就和Filter、Struts的Interceptor很类似,提供它的主要作用就是为了很好的降低代码的耦合性,提供代码的内聚性。下面我们就看看CXF的Interceptor是怎么样工作的。1、 我们就用上面的H转载 2015-09-08 16:09:24 · 639 阅读 · 0 评论 -
一、CXF与springMVC整合的webService发布
1、关于spring不多说,用到cxf插件,则需要导入一些列jar包,我这里用的是maven管理jar包,在pom.xml文件中的maven依赖如下: org.apache.cxf cxf-rt-frontend-jaxws ${cxf.version} org.apache.cxf cxf-r原创 2015-09-08 09:44:05 · 14934 阅读 · 1 评论 -
如何调用发布好的webService
方式一:通过在spring的配置文件中加入如下配置<jaxws:client id="helloClient" serviceClass="com.gstd.service.controller.HelloWorld" address="http://localhost:7600/oa/webservice/Hello原创 2015-09-08 11:57:47 · 847 阅读 · 0 评论